This artwork was definitely not kicking around on the original website. The Old Tunes weren't even a known quantity to the general public back then - they had those 3 audio samples on the website, and even Closes Vol. 1 and Catalog 3 weren't originally listed on their discography until later on.

I always thought that was strange to add those two after the fact, for these releases all supposedly being invented to add mystique to their backstory and Boards being apparently annoyed by all the queries surrounding them, to add 2 more unobtainable releases to the pile a year or so later seemed like a weird choice - but you know, as much as they claim to dislike attention, they have a lot of fun participating in attention seeking behavior as long as there is minimal effort attached to it (just look at their current Twitter game). I guess its a Gemini thing, I know how it is!

In terms of what we could hear from them circa 1998-1999 when that website was active, Hi Scores was obtainable through official means but tricky to find, Twoism was only a low quality vinyl rip and Maxima hadn't leaked yet.

I still remember that Twoism reissue being announced and thinking they would just keep working their way back through the catalog and maybe give us one a year...what sweet summer children we were back then...

Maxima is kind of different, it wasn't intentionally concealed in the same manor as others. It was used as a demo tape to send to various record labels IIRC so its leaking was almost inevitable. In the case of Old Tunes, I think that perhaps it being a compilation of the Brother's favorites from that period of time would indicate that it wasn't something they were as sensitive about having people hear.

In the case of Random 35 Tracks, I have a feeling that if they knew who released it, someone's kneecaps would have been broken. Not sure whether physically or metaphorically at this point, but I would imagine that something was done. That is the only leak that one would feel that they aren't comfortable having out there. I really doubt that the leaking of older tapes is inevitable.

We will most likely get to hear more, though. At some point. I have a feeling based on whispers and interview segments that they were going through the catalogue and organizing their older tapes.
